Family:  Gobiidae (Gobies), subfamily: Gobionellinae
Max. size:  8 cm TL (male/unsexed)
Environment:  demersal; freshwater; brackish; marine, amphidromous
Distribution:  Asia: Japan and in the Kuril islands.
Diagnosis:  Dorsal spines (total): 8-8; Dorsal soft rays (total): 10-10; Anal spines: 1-1; Anal soft rays: 9-9
Biology:  Inhabits freshwater lakes and streams (Ref. 81467). The females show breeding colors. Caught for food in Japan.
IUCN Red List Status: Least Concern (LC); Date assessed: 06 March 2020 Ref. (130435)
Threat to humans:  harmless
